Commpression? 140-160

After I read Chris's recent post I ran a compression test on my 72 142 E, D-jet and it was 135 on two and 115 on the other two. Obviously, the two low ones are a problem, but how much of a problem? What should it run? The plugs all look about the same, a little white look. The car doesn't have the power that my old beater does with 335K, a Weber, and a lot of blue smoke on deaceleration.

My guess is the engine would run another 100K easy, but it would be nice to have a little more power. Suggestions?
